Spinach Pie
2 rolls of store-bought pie crust
a kilo of frozen,very very finely chopped spinach
3-4 tablespoons of creme fraiche
a 210 gm bag of Gruyere cheese
salt and pepper to taste
1 large onion, chopped fine
1 egg, lightly whisked
De-frost the spinach and squeeze out all the water.
In a pan, heat a little oil and fry the onion for a while.
In a mixing bowl, combine the spinach, the onion, the seasoning, the cheese and the creme fraiche.
Place one of the pie crusts at the bottom of a pie dish. Fill with the spinach mixture and spread it evenly. Cover with the second pie crust.
Brush the top with the egg and bake at 175degreesC till done.
